I never personally used fuelly, but if the sig they have is like ours, you can use it on any site. The main thing is to get the correct image link and put the [ img ] brackets around the link. The [url] bracket is to make it link to your fuel log page. If you can't get it, pm me your profile on fuelly and I'll see what I can do with it.
